Providence Friars Preview
The Providence Friars have an 11-11 record this season and are sitting in 8th place in the Big East. Providence is coming off a 66-68 loss over Saint John’s. The Friars are 11-11 against the spread, and 10-11-1 in over/under, while having a 9-2 home record.
Offensively, Providence is averaging 71.6 points per game, which ranks 254th in the nation. Defensively, they allow 69.3 points per game (110th). The Friars shoot 44% from the field (229th) and 345% from beyond the arc (121st). The Friars shoot 70.3% from the free-throw line (232nd) and are grabbing 38.5 rebounds per game (45th).
Jayden Pierre leads Providence in scoring with an average of 12.8 points and 2.6 rebounds, while Bensley Joseph adds 11.9 points and 4.1 rebounds per game. Providence will meet Butler after this game.
Creighton Bluejays Preview
The Creighton Bluejays have a 16-6 record this season and are sitting in third place in the Big East. They are coming off a 62-60 win over Villanova. The Bluejays are 13-7-2 against the spread, and 9-13 in over/under, while having a 4-3 road record.
Offensively, Creighton is averaging 75.4 points per game, which ranks 157th in the nation. Defensively, they allow 68.3 points per game (82nd). The Bluejays shoot 47.9% from the field (45th) and 34.9% from beyond the arc (129th). The Bluejays shoot 74.9% from the free-throw line (80th) and are grabbing 37.4 rebounds per game (91st).
Ryan Kalkbrenner leads Creighton in scoring with an average of 18.5 points and a team-high 8.4 rebounds, while Steven Ashworth adds 16.3 points, 4.1 rebounds, and a team-high 6.8 assists per game.
